How are design artefacts created and shared in situations where a range of professional and users are taking shared responsibility for the creation of new systems? this project has a focus on discourse and representation, within a healthcare setting, as a component of the NIHR Collaboration for Leadership in Applied Health Research and Care (CLAHRC) programme http://www.clahrc-cp.nihr.ac.uk/
